What is the advantage of Revit over AutoCAD?

Unlike AutoCAD, Revit allows all project data to be stored in a single project file, permitting multiple users to work on the same project file and merge their changes with every save. All changes in Revit are coordinated across the entire project, so a change in one place (view) is a simultaneous change in all views.31 juil. 2014

How much does a Revit license cost?

How much does a Revit subscription cost? The price of an annual Revit subscription is $2,545 and the price of a monthly Revit subscription is $320. The price of a 3-year Revit subscription is $6,870. Free trial and financing available, purchase includes 30-day money back guarantee.

Should I learn AutoCAD or Revit?

A good way to look at the benefits of each tool is AutoCAD is great for 2D drawing, where only precise line work is needed, such as elevation detail drawings. Revit is great for modeling, generating cost schedules, collaboration and change management. In the industry of design and construction, competition is fierce.
